EASTERN HEIGHTS AREA - LIMITED PRECAUTIONARY BOIL ADVISORY
Highway 1054 from Clement Road south to Highway 40; Highway 40 from Hilltop East to Sweetwater Road; East Cooper Road to corner of North Cooper Road; all side roads in listed area.
On October 15, 2025, Tangipahoa Water District Contractor was attempting to put new lines in the Loranger/Independence area and hit a 3” line causing an outage in the area.
All customers in the listed area should follow the Limited Precautionary Boil Advisory. Out of the abundance of caution and in accordance with the Louisiana Department of Health regulation, a limited precautionary boil advisory is in place.
This BOIL ADVISORY is to remain in effect until rescinded by Tangipahoa Water District. It is recommended that all customers disinfect their water before consuming it (including fountain drinks), making ice, brushing teeth, or using for food preparation or rinsing of food by the following means:
Boil water for {1} full minute in a clean container. The one-minute starts after the water has been brought to a rolling boil. (The flat taste can be eliminated by shaking the water in a clean bottle, pouring it from one clean container to another, or by adding a small pinch of salt to each quart of water that is boiled.)
Tangipahoa Water District will rescind the Boil Advisory upon notification from the Louisiana Department of Health - Office of Public Health that additional water samples collected from our water supply system have shown our water to be safe.
Customers affected by this advisory will be advised when it is rescinded. Notices will be posted on the Tangipahoa Water District Website and social media sites. If you have any questions, please call Tangipahoa Water District at 985-345-6457.
